The Z3X Easy JTAG eMMC File Manager v1.18 is a specialized software tool designed for technicians and developers working with mobile phone hardware, specifically targeting eMMC (Embedded MultiMediaCard) memory chips. Released around June 2020, this version was a significant update in the Z3X ecosystem, known for its ability to interface directly with the internal storage of Android and other mobile devices. Core Functionality and Features
The eMMC File Manager acts as a bridge between the raw data on a memory chip and a user-friendly interface. Key features of version 1.18 include:
Native File System Support: It utilizes a native engine-driver to access and browse EXT2, EXT3, and EXT4 file systems common in Android devices.
Partition Management: Technicians can scan for partition tables manually, helping to map data on damaged or non-standard layouts.
Data Recovery: The tool allows for the extraction of sensitive user data like contacts, SMS, and passwords through dedicated "Hot Links".
Direct Chip Access: Unlike standard USB debugging, it allows for reading and writing directly to the eMMC chip via JTAG, ISP (In-System Programming), or SD interfaces. z3x easy jtag emmc file manager 1.18 download
Speed and Stability: Supports CLK bus frequencies up to 21 MHz and offers high-speed reading through automated folder structure buffering. Technical Application
The tool is primarily used for boot repair and dead phone recovery. When a device is "bricked" and cannot boot into its operating system, the eMMC File Manager allows a technician to bypass the software entirely. By connecting the Z3X Easy-Jtag Plus Box to the chip's pins, users can: Repair or update eMMC firmware. Resize or format partitions. Flash factory firmware directly onto the chip. Z3X Easy JTAG eMMC File Manager 1.18 is a critical software utility for mobile technicians working with chip-level repairs, data recovery, and digital forensics. This version, released in mid-2020, introduced important experimental features like RPMB area reading and enhanced support for high-version box firmware. Key Features of Version 1.18 Experimental RPMB Reading
: Added the ability to experimentally read the Replay Protected Memory Block (RPMB) section by selecting it in the ROM combo box. RPMB Status Logging
: The program log now displays whether data has ever been written to the RPMB area (e.g., "programmed and written 12 times" or "clear"). Firmware Requirements : Specifically designed for the "second box" hardware; it requires box firmware 2.52 or higher to function. Android File Explorer
: Offers a comprehensive file explorer for eMMC partitions with support for FAT, FAT32, EXT3, EXT4, and NTFS mount protocols. Download and Installation

The Z3X Easy JTAG eMMC File Manager v1.18 is a specialized software addon released on June 29, 2020, designed for the Z3X Easy JTAG Plus hardware. It functions as a powerful data recovery and file management tool, allowing technicians to interact directly with a device's internal eMMC storage. Core Features and Capabilities
Version 1.18 introduced several significant technical improvements and features:
Native Engine-Driver: A rebuilt-from-scratch engine written in C++ for faster, native access to EXT2, EXT3, and EXT4 file systems.
Enhanced File Management: Users can browse files in a tree-style partition manager, view file information, and perform multiple selections.
